FINE+RARE, Apr 2023

The limestone slopes of Moulin Saint-Georges allowed the Vauthiers to produce a wine with 3.51pH despite the warmth of the vintage. The nose is sweet and rich – with confit cherry, plum compote, cherry kernel and a hint of vanilla. The palate is fulsome with more of that ripe, generous fruit, cut by the surprising freshness and smooth tannins. Blend: 80% Merlot, 20% Cabernet Franc

Punteggio 92-94/100 · Jeff Leve, The Wine Cellar Insider, May 2023

Initially you notice the toasty oak before moving to the incense, spice, flowers, and smoked plums in the nose. On the palate, the wine is creamy, supple, fresh and polished, leaving you with the sensation of lushness on the palate that carries through to the finish. 80% percent Merlot and 20% Cabernet Franc create the blend. 14.5 ABV%, 3.52 Ph. Drink from 2026-2042.

Punteggio 92-94/100 · Lisa Perrotti-Brown MW, Wine Advocate, May 2023

A blend of 80% Merlot and 20% Cabernet Franc, the 2022 Moulin Saint-Georges has a deep garnet-purple color. It bursts with bombastic scents of juicy black plums, blueberry pie, and warm cassis, leading to touches of cedar chest, menthol, and lavender. Big, rich, and full-bodied in the mouth, the palate is completely coated with black and blue fruits, supported by firm, velvety tannins, finishing long and decadent. It will need some time to come round, but promises to be a blockbuster!

Punteggio 93-95/100 · Jeb Dunnuck, May 2023

Rocking Merlot notes of ripe black cherries, currants, smoked tobacco, and melted chocolate all emerge from the 2022 Château Moulin Saint Georges, a ripe, full-bodied, opulent, seamless 2020 based on 80% Merlot and 20% Cabernet Franc. It has the density and structure of the vintage and will have 15-20 years of overall longevity.

Bottled as a Saint-Emilion Grand Cru, Ch. Moulin Saint-Georges has risen to prominence under the ownership of the Vauthier family, of Ch. Ausone.
